About the Club

history3The David Brown Tractor Club was formed by Martin George in the Spring of 1995. He wanted a focus for David Brown enthusiasts to get together, to source parts, and to give and receive information. The object of the Club, as defined in the Club Rules, is “To preserve and further the name of David Brown, David Brown Tractors, implements and machines worldwide. To bring together al David Brown tractor owners, past employers, past and present distributors and anyone interested in the former David Brown Tractor organisation. It shall be non profit making”.

The club's initial meeting and all quarterly meetings since have taken place at Durker Roods Hotel, Meltham, Huddersfield, which was Mr. David Brown's home up until the early 1970's. David Brown tractors are still popular the world over and this is one of the reasons for the David Brown Tractor Club's success. Our membership is over 1000 and members come from all over the globe. Our quarterly magazine 'Tractor News' brings features on restorations, machines still in use and technical articles from experts who worked within the company.
